KUCHING: A group of Barisan Nasional backbenchers representing rural seaside towns and villages is urging the state government to set up a coastal development authority.
They say the body could be modelled after the Regional Corridor Development Authority, which is coordinating the heavy industralisation masterplan for the central region.
